GetRegionChangesList: различия между версиями

Материал из Справочная система Россельхознадзора
Перейти к навигации Перейти к поиску
Строка 33: Строка 33:
| [[Объект ..Request/updateDateInterval|'''updateDateInterval''']] || Интервал дат || [[DateInterval|bs:DateInterval]] || 0..1
| [[Объект ..Request/updateDateInterval|'''updateDateInterval''']] || Интервал дат || [[DateInterval|bs:DateInterval]] || 0..1
|}
|}


===Объект [[#Объект getRegionChangesList|..Request]]/listOptions===
===Объект [[#Объект getRegionChangesList|..Request]]/listOptions===

Версия 11:14, 5 сентября 2016

Общие сведения

Метод позволяет получить историю изменений в списке регионов. Выполнение операции заканчивается возвратом списка регионов. В список попадают записи, дата изменения которых, попадает во временной интервал, указанный в запросе. Метод поддерживает возможность частичного вывода списка.

Используемые пространства имён и типы

Данные запроса

Объект getRegionChangesList

Корневой объект запроса.

Поле Описание Тип данных Обязательность
listOptions Параметры запрашиваемого списка bs:ListOptions 0..1
updateDateInterval Интервал дат bs:DateInterval 0..1

Объект ..Request/listOptions

Объект содержит два параметра запрашиваемого списка: количество выводимых объектов и смещение относительно начала.

Поле Описание Тип данных Обязательность
count Количество значений в списке
  • По умолчанию значение равно 100;
  • Максимально допустимое значение равно 1000
xs:nonNegativeInteger 0..1
offset Смещение в списке относительно начала xs:nonNegativeInteger 0..1


Объект ..Request/updateDateInterval

Объект содержит сведения об интервале времени, за который необходимо получить обновления.

Поле Описание Тип Обязательность
beginDate Дата, начиная с которой пользователь получит историю изменений записей стран. bs:DataInterval 1
endDate Конец временного интервала.
  • В случае, если компонента endDate не указана, то используется текущая дата.
bs:DataInterval 0..1